Ingredients
Ingredients for Classic Sausage Stuffing
- 1 pound Italian sausage
- 1 onion, diced
- 2 celery stalks, chopped
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on dried sage
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per
- 8 cups cubed crusty bread
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
- 1/2 cup butter, melted
Mix all the ingredients thoroughly before baking.
Instructions
Prepare the Sausage
In a large skillet over medium heat, cook the sausage until browned. Then, add the onion and celery and sauté until softened.
Combine Ingredients
In a large bowl, combine the sausage mixture with cubed bread, herbs, and melted butter. Gradually add chicken broth until the mixture is moist but not soggy.
Bake the Stuffing
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Transfer the stuffing to a greased baking dish and cover with aluminum foil. Bake for 30 minutes, then uncover and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es for a crispy top.
Let the stuffing sit for a few minutes before serving. Enjoy!

Storage and Reheating
If you have leftovers, store your Classic Sausage Stuffing in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will typically keep well for about 3-4 days. To ensure that it tastes just as delicious the next time you enjoy it, consider reheating it in the oven.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C), cover the stuffing with foil, and heat until warmed through, about 20-30 minutes.
If you're planning ahead, you can also freeze the stuffing before baking. Simply prepare it up to the baking step and freeze. When you're ready to enjoy it, thaw it overnight in the refrigerator, then bake as directed. This allows you to have delicious homemade stuffing with minimal effort on the day of your holiday gathering.

Questions About Recipes
→ Can I make this stuffing 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the stuffing a day in advance and refrigerate it. Just bake it before serving.
→ Is it possible to make this stuffing gluten-free?
Absolutely! Just use gluten-free bread as a substitute.
